Sociology:Exploring the Architecture of Everyday Life, Eighth Edition
With a praised writing style that reads like a book you'd pore over at the corner cafAc, this bestselling core text starts in a familiar place - the student's everyday world - and then introduces sociological concepts and institutions as they impact the student's daily existence. Full of vivid real-world examples and touching personal vignettes, this text offers a solid introduction to basic sociological concepts and helps students realize their role in constructing, planning, maintaining, and fixing society.

The Engaged Sociologist, Third Edition
This unique book brings the public sociology movement into the classroom, teaching students in a fun, engaging way how to use the tools of sociology to become effective participants in our democratic society.
